    how much is everyone spending on a 2 and 3 tier cake to make and then too sell. i got a stuff from asda,
    blanket, bath towel and cloth, booties, muslins, elastic bands all in all for 2 tier with 32 nappies is £14 to make and sell say £20 and for 3 tier with 69 nappies its £20 to make and sell for £25
    im not sure if that is too cheap to sell them on
    where are people buying bath towels and blankets etc from
    also i was getting pampers nappies is there a decent cheap one i should know of?

    i get my blankets from matalan £4 or b&m bargains £3,socks from Matalan and thick socks for my cupcakes from asda,i sell my 1 tiers at £20,2 tiers at £25 and three tiers at £35,i make around £17 on my 3 tier cakes
    muslins from B&M 3pack for £2,towels from Asda or matalan,booties from matalan

    i stock up on huggies/pampers when on offer and i always buy size 3 so's mum dont have to open cake right away.

    at the mo nappies have a 3rd off at boots :D

    Thats a lot of nappies, I use between 30 and 35 for a 3 tier. Do you roll or swirl? I roll for the bottom 2 tiers as i find it takes far less, I got through so many when i tried swirling. Nappies tend to cost around £3, £3.50 for a 3 tier but would of been double if i used the amount you do x

    Yes you are definatley using far too many nappies. I also always use size 3 pampers.
    I normally charge £20 for a single tier, £30for a 2 tier and £40/£50 for a 3 tier ... again depends how much I put into the 3 tiers.
    Offices normally go for the 3 tier that is why I do a £50 one. This has same amount of nappies but 2 suits, 2 johnsons products, 2 socks and a nicer soft toy!
